Autumn Brew Review 2007

Saturday, September 29th, 1-6pm at the old Grain Belt brewery complex. Tickets are $25 and are available through Ticketworks. Tickets will be available at the door for $30. Beer? Yes. Plenty. Here is a list of current participating breweries:

The Swelling Ranks of Contributors & a New Brewpub in Town?

Hey all. I just wanted to drop a quick note informing readers that a husband/wife tag-team answered the call for contributors, adding two more to the ranks at MNBeer. It’s nice to know that being a chubby beer drinker does, in fact, qualify one for certain opportunities from time to time (uh, honey, I mean me).

On a different note, while driving through Waverly, MN (just west of the Metro on Hwy 12), I noticed what appears to be a new brewpub under construction – All American Grill & Brewhouse. I’ve yet to find any more information on this, but will continue to dig. If anyone knows anything about this, let us know.

New Brewpub in St. Cloud! McCann’s Food & Brew

Good news from St. Cloud – McCann’s Food and Brew will be occupying and remodeling the recently-closed O’Hara’s space. Chris Laumb, O’Hara’s brewer, will once again be brewing at 33rd & 3rd in St. Cloud. We’re happy to hear that Chris is once again gainfully employed in the Minnesota brewing scene. He’ll be brewing all new beers at McCann’s, so if you’ve got a suggestion or an old favorite, feel free to post it here. If things stay on track, look for a fall opening.
